When considering Cat6 HDMI extenders for 2026, buyers should focus on a few essential features. First, the maximum distance for signal transmission is crucial. Many extenders maintain quality up to 100 meters, while some offer enhanced performance over longer distances. This feature is vital for large home theaters or conference rooms.
Next, the resolution supported by the extender is equally important. Opt for devices that can handle 4K or even 8K resolutions. A good extender should also support HDR for vibrant colors and improved contrast. Compatibility with different formats ensures versatility in various settings.
Additionally, look for extenders with built-in PoE (Power over Ethernet) functionality. This feature simplifies installation by eliminating the need for extra power adapters. However, some models may have issues with heat dissipation over extended use. Thus, monitoring performance during long operation periods is advised. Lastly, consider the durability of the device. A well-constructed model withstands wear and tear, ensuring a longer lifespan.

When evaluating Cat6 HDMI extenders, several key metrics emerge. First, consider the maximum transmission distance. Many extenders support distances up to 200 feet. This distance can impact your setup, especially in larger spaces. Check the specifications before purchasing.
Another critical metric is video and audio quality. Cat6 HDMI extenders should transmit 4K video with minimal latency. Look for extenders that support HDR for the best color and contrast. High-quality sound must accompany the video for an immersive experience.

When considering Cat6 HDMI extenders, buyers face a wide array of options. The price range varies significantly. Affordable extenders are typically available for under $50. These models can transmit signals over moderate distances. They work well for basic setups, yet may lack some advanced features. Users often report mixed experiences with their durability and performance.
On the premium end, prices can soar above $200. These extenders often come with enhanced features. They support higher resolutions and longer transmission distances. Users find them more reliable for professional settings. Customer reviews often highlight superior build quality and better signal integrity. However, the price may not justify the benefits for casual users. Potential buyers should carefully evaluate their needs before purchasing.
